**Vendor note: Inkmill markdown pipeline**

Rendering for Parchway docs is outsourced to Inkmill under an annual contract, renewing each March. They handle sanitization and PDF export; we own the upload queue. SLA: 4-hour response on rendering failures. Escalate only after two failed retries. Their support desk is reachable at the address below.

billing contact of hahaf-baguf = zorael.tammir.jorius@sivrelhq.internal

Export all existing flags from the legacy toggles table, then run `lampwick import --verify`, which checks each flag for orphaned targeting rules and unsigned override entries. Note for review: imported flags default to off and require a signed approval record before activation, closing the gap where legacy flags activated on import. Audit every flag whose owner field is empty before proceeding. The importer writes directly to the rollout database using the connection string below.

primary connection of tajeg-tajop = postgresql://julax_svc:DI@db-e7f3.kelvidyn.corp:5432/rusdor

Handover: firmware update channel (Ostley Devices). Future maintainers — the "stable" channel for the Wrenbeck sensor line is served by the updater service in the fleet cluster. Rollouts are staged by cohort; the canary cohort gets builds 48 hours ahead. If a rollout stalls, check the manifest signer first — it's the usual culprit. Promotion between channels is manual by design; do not automate it without sign-off. The channel configuration currently in effect is below.

config for kafof-bawef:
holath:
  log_level: debug
  metrics_host: metrics.holath.qorvelsys.internal
  pin: 2191
  pool_size: 32

**09:41** — The Refillo restock planner began generating duplicate routes for the Marwick depot fleet. Investigation showed the overnight inventory sync had completed twice, and the planner's idempotency check compared timestamps at second granularity, which both runs shared. Operators dispatched four redundant trucks before the on-call engineer paused scheduling at 09:58. A granularity fix and a dedupe guard were merged and deployed by 11:20. The corrected build is identified by the trace token below.

session token of yajof-bagef = htk4_937d